Croatian coach Krunoslav Jurčić of Pyramids FC has named his team's squad heading to Morocco to face AS FAR in the first leg of the CAF Champions League quarter-finals.

The squad is as follows:

Goalkeepers: Ahmed El Shenawy, Mahmoud Gad, Sherif Ekramy

Defenders: Ahmed Samy, Osama Galal, Mohamed El Sheiibi, Mahmoud Marei, Karim Hafez

Midfielders: Mohanad Lasheen, Mahmoud Zalaka, Nasser Maher, Awda Fakhoury, Mostafa Ziko, Everton da Silva, Hamed Hamdan, Pascal Ferry, Ahmed Tawfik, Ahmed Atef Qata, Mostafa Fathi

Forwards: Fiston Mayele, Youssef Obama, Marwan Hamdy, Dodo El Gabbas

The first leg is scheduled to take place at the Prince Moulay Abdellah Sports Complex in Rabat on Friday, March 13, at 22:00 GMT. Somali referee Omar Artan will officiate the match, with Ghanaian Daniel Laryea in charge of the VAR room, assisted by Libyan Ahmed El Shalmani.
